pondering a vehicle purchase, it's crucial to understand
your alternatives. There are more
considerations than merely
new or utilized; going down the
used-vehicle course will likewise
require an option between buying from a personal seller or
a dealership. Even amongst
secondhand vehicles at
the dealer lot, there's a subset
promoted as "certified
pre-owned," or CPO, which are
generally offered through
certified new-car dealers.
Considering that they
generally come with
a better service warranty,
fairly modest miles, and a thorough
assessment, CPO
vehicles strike a
possibly engaging happy medium
between brand-new and utilized. <BR>
Here are 5 reasons a
licensed pre-owned (CPO)
car might be right
for you: <BR> 1. It's Cheaper Than Purchasing New <BR>
Let's get the most
obvious factor out of the way. New
vehicles and trucks are, by
nature, more expensive than their utilized
brethren. Usually, two-year-old CPO
lorries are
generally 25 percent cheaper, and those 4 years old tend to be 40 percent less
costly.
It
is important to remember that
CPO vehicles do bring a premium
over their non-CPO utilized counterparts.
The concern purchasers need to ask
themselves is: Do the fringe benefits of purchasing a
CPO justify the greater cost?
<BR> 2. There's a Manufacturer-Backed Warranty <BR> Which gets us into another
reason a CPO makes
good sense for specific buyers.
Due to the fact that with that premium,
automakers use a
range of manufacturer-backed guarantees. Similar to the
automobiles and trucks they
help certify, not all
warranties are
produced equal,
however, so purchasers will want
to pay unique attention to the
service warranty specifics. There are
powertrain-limited service warranties and
bumper-to-bumper service warranties, and
a number of automakers
use combinations of both. <BR> Powertrain
guarantees
generally span longer
periods, such as 6 years or 100,000 miles from
the date the automobile was
bought brand-new. A bumper-to-bumper
warranty might last for one
year or cover 12,000 miles and could consist of
a deductible of $50 to $100. When shopping for a CPO, buyers need to be sure to
ask about the length of the
warranty, the details
regarding kinds of
repair work that need paying a deductible, and
the list of products not covered at all. Also,
focus on whether
the producer has a cost to
move a CPO guarantee
must you want to
sell the vehicle or truck
prior to the guarantee
ends.
(BMW, for instance, charges $200 for the
service warranty to be transferred to
a subsequent owner.). <BR> 3. The Vehicle
Has Actually Been Inspected. <BR> Among the reasons a warranty is provided in the first
location is since
makers make certain
CPO cars, trucks, and SUVs
are in solid working order before
they provide them up for sale. Unlike an as-is
used cars and
truck that you'll discover on a dealer lot
or listed by a personal seller, CPO
lorries are put through a relatively comprehensive
assessment list.
Ford and General Motors, for instance, have 172
products the automakers state
service technicians
should complete before approving a used Ford, Buick, GMC, or Chevrolet
lorry as CPO. If you're not
particularly mechanically likely, the
relative assurance purchasing CPO
can provide could be well worth it. <BR>

picture-in-picture" allowfullscreen></iframe><BR> 4. CPO
Vehicles Still Have a Great Deal Of
Life in Them. <BR> To qualify as CPO, an automobile generally
needs to fulfill age and mileage
constraints. This, too,
varies by manufacturer, however
typically CPO
cars and trucks and trucks are not
more than 5 to 6 years old and have
fewer than 75,000 miles on them. The
majority of manufacturers will include advantages such as 24-hour roadside
service and SiriusXM radio with a CPO purchase. <BR> 5. You Get
Less Variety, But CPOs You'll Discover
Are Option. <BR> If you're looking for a Porsche 911 with a manual transmission and
a few particular
options-- as we
frequently aimlessly discover ourselves
doing-- looking for out one that is
provided as a CPO is most likely
just this side of difficult. Even when
looking for something more
typical, among utilized
vehicles on a
dealership lot, the large majority aren't CPO.
One car dealership in Ann Arbor, Michigan,
for instance, has actually 1507
used automobiles
listed for sale on its website, just 63 of
which are CPO. The smaller sized numbers are
discussed-- and warranted-- by
the variety of requirements we have
actually just described that CPO
automobiles need to
satisfy. Some automakers
give buyers a period, such as 3 days or 150 miles,
to check out a CPO and decide whether
they 'd rather swap it out for something else.<BR><BR>
